“My golden retriever Honey is a rescue dog with severe separation anxiety. She cannot be in a crate and can be destructive when she’s left alone. Laura kept her for a week while I was on vacation. It was a wonderful experience! Laura and her pack made Honey feel right at home. She played outside with them in the fenced in yard and took daily walks. Honey had no problems with anxiety, and Laura made it a point not to leave her alone all week! I got frequent photo and video updates, which reassured me that Honey was happy and relaxed. When I came to pick her up, I’m not sure she was ready to leave! I will definitely be returning to Laura when I need a pet sitter again. She took excellent care of Honey and gave her a fabulous “vacation”! Laura is knowledgeable and experienced with pets, and you can trust her even if your pet has special needs.”
